Risk transfer, adequately insured subcontractors, mold, EIFS/DEFS, Cincinnati's Commercial General Liability rewrite, residential contractors and construction defects are all factors that require increased consideration when evaluating new and renewal contractor accounts. This course addresses all these risks, which affect the potential liability of your contractor clients.

This class enhances your expertise as an account representative by providing in-depth information on surety basics including both contract and commercial surety. Emphasis is placed on understanding the underwriting process, basic understanding of financial statements and work-in-progress reports, bond forms, rating and classification of contractors and an overview of commercial surety.

The Future Insurance Professional Internship Program (FIPI) will help you more easily attract talented individuals who will support your agency’s perpetuation plan. Highly motivated, energetic college students who are within 1-2 years of graduation will benefit from participating in our program, which combines training and work experience. This internship will help your most promising insurance beginners make greater contributions to your agency in the future. This program kicks off once per year mid- to late-May each year.
We offer 12 seats to agency interns, where we focus on key areas that specifically help interns see the benefits of a career path in insurance and return to their agencies with applicable knowledge of the property casualty insurance industry.
